Mina Zhan
About Mina
Mina Zhan’s practice focuses on corporate formation and compliance, regulatory compliance, and commercial transactions (including M&A, joint ventures, and buy-sell). She also leads clients through employment and HR compliance issues, customs and trade matters, and trademark portfolio management, providing practical, business-oriented counsel that aligns legal objectives with commercial goals.
Before joining Smith Gambrell & Russell, Mina’s practice focused on business dispute resolution, restrictive covenants, employment law, Equal Employment Opportunity Commission (EEOC) claims, and Fair Labor Standards Act (FLSA) litigation. She also has developed a strong international background by practicing corporate law and Intellectual Property (“IP”) law in China, during which she counseled international companies in business formation and compliance and brand protection matters.
